The volume explores the syntax of nominalizations, focusing on
deverbal and deadjectival nominalizations, but also discussing the
syntax of genitives and the syntax of distinct readings of
nominalizations. The volume investigates the morpholgy-syntax
interface as well as the semantics-syntax interface in the domain
of nominalizations. The theoretical frameworks include distributed
morphology, and minimalist syntax. Data from a variety of languages
are taken into consideration, e.g. Hebrew, Bulgarian, Serbian,
French, Spanish, German and English.
